A Solution-Focused Group Program for Enhancing Parental Competence

Abstract
This study sought to verify the effectiveness of a six-week Solution-Focused Group Program for low-income parents, helping them, in two-hour sessions, to enhance their childrearing practices and increase theirself-esteem and sense of competence. Participants included 16 mothers and fathers of elementary school children; eight were assigned to the experimental group and eightto the control group. The pre- and post-test scores of the two groups were analysed and compared using chi-square, the Man-Whitney U test, and the Wilcoxon Signed-Ranks test. Measurements included the Conflict Tactics Scale, the Self-Esteem Scale, the Parenting Sense of Competence Scale, and solution-focused scaling questions. Results revealed significant differences between the two groups in terms of the changes made in all three areas, thereby confirming the effectiveness of the program. The authors conclude that the program could be successfully employed by community-based family therapists to strengthen healthy family functioning.
